Transaction 53edff2583dbaa8c8d7bf1afacfc928a98da0d433412703560dd40faa89ae31b

20 Input
2 Outputs
  • 53edff2583dbaa8c8d7bf1afacfc928a98da0d433412703560dd40faa89ae31b:0
  • value  1000077
    address  1FUHHjiEzfshxg9wwtPs8TYMQqmGA7n8D7
  • 53edff2583dbaa8c8d7bf1afacfc928a98da0d433412703560dd40faa89ae31b:1
  • value  831535380
    address  1BLf3QRjxhd4jwxGjXiFmLHYnR6zPUMUNk